2022年12月14日
Spring Boot
我虽然之前接触过不少次spring,但是深度、商业级的应用这还是第一次。
我打算在工作的同时,根据各种实际应用到的场景和产生的困惑来学习Spring Boot的应用方法、特性和底层原理。
先谈谈我的第一印象:
印象
刚入职的一段时间Leader让我自己看项目代码。我接触工作代码的第一印象就是:分离、注解超多和迷迷糊糊的环境。
我花了超多的时间在配置环境上面、包括maven,jre,sql,npm,vue,redis,etc.
最终终于顺利运行了!我现在对yml已经有了更加深入的理解。
但是,对于maven细致的操作、从头开始配置搭建一个项目以及运行/build项目时的configuration我还是需要加强理解
并且我总是在设置服务器以及合并代码的时候浪费时间。
以后还是要熟悉使用服务器的流程,并且多了解一下git fancy一点的使用。
Git
在git的使用中,我总是遇到这种情况:
我需要把需求合并成一个commit,但是在做的期间有时master会有改动,这就需要我merge进来改动conflict。但是merge的行动又会产生一些没有必要的commit,并且有些没有办法rebase(也可能是我瞎操作没弄对)。
有时候自暴自弃我干脆直接开个新branch重新搞算了。。。
希望能找到合适的方法8。